Description

  • Manage daily processing activities - ensuring that money shown as received on CRM systems agrees with actual monies received.
  • Resolving any invoice discrepancies.
  • Gift aid - along with the manager, put together and check gift aid claims.
  • Answer internal gift aid queries.
  • Control the 24 hour coding system - Working with the Customer Services team; release income batches as appropriate.
  • Reconcile the batches outstanding to the income suspense.
